High-strength structural bolting assemblies for preloading - Part 3: System HR - Hexagon bolt and nut assemblies

This part of this European Standard specifies, together with prEN 14399-1, the requirements for assemblies of high-strength structural bolts and nuts of system HR suitable for preloaded joints with large widths across flats, thread sizes M12 to M36 and property classes 8.8/8 and 10.9/10.Bolt and nut assemblies to this part of this European Standard have been designed to allow preloading of at least 0,7 fub´As according to ENV 1993-1-1 (Eurocode 3) and to obtain ductility predominantly by plastic elongation of the bolt. For this purpose the components have the following characteristics:¾ nut height according to style 1 (see ISO 4032)¾ thread length of the bolt according to ISO 888Bolt and nut assemblies to this part of this European Standard include washers according to prEN 14399-6 or to prEN 14399-5 (under the nut only).NOTEAttention is drawn to the importance of ensuring that the bolts are correctly used if satisfactory result are to be ob-tained. For recommendations concerning proper application, reference to ENV 1090-1 is made.The test method for suitability for preloading is specified in prEN 14399-2.
